Operation platform for geological information system
Technical Field
The utility model relates to a geology relevant equipment field, in particular to geology is operation platform for information system.

Drawings
Fig. 1 is a schematic diagram of an overall structure of an operation platform for a geological information system according to the present invention;
fig. 2 is a schematic diagram of the overall structure of the closed state of the operation platform for the geological information system according to the present invention;
fig. 3 is a schematic view of the overall structure of the connection structure of the operation platform for the geological information system according to the present invention;
fig. 4 is a schematic connection diagram of the protection cover of the operation platform for the geological information system of the present invention.
In the figure: 1. a platform body; 2. a drive wheel; 3. an operation box; 4. a storage groove; 5. a display screen slot; 6. a connecting structure; 7. a protective cover; 61. a first fixed block; 62. a connecting plate; 63. fixing the rod; 64. a second fixed block; 65. a connecting screw; 71. a first protection plate; 72. a second protection plate; 73. a first protection groove; 74. no. two protection groove.

As shown in fig. 1-4, an operation platform for a geological information system comprises a platform main body 1, driving wheels 2 are fixedly connected to four corners of the lower end of the platform main body 1, an operation box 3 is fixedly connected to the lower portion of the front end of the platform main body 1, an object storage groove 4 is fixedly connected to the upper portion of the left end of the platform main body 1, a display screen groove 5 is formed in the middle of the upper end of the platform main body 1, a connecting structure 6 is connected to the rear groove wall of the display screen groove 5 in a threaded manner, a protective cover 7 is connected to the upper portion of the rear end of the connecting structure 6 in a threaded manner, and the rear groove wall of the display screen groove 5 is.
The connecting structure 6 comprises a first fixing block 61, the left part and the right part of the upper end of the first fixing block 61 are fixedly connected with connecting plates 62, the middle parts of the two connecting plates 62 are fixedly connected with a fixing rod 63 together, the middle part of the outer surface of the fixing rod 63 is movably connected with a second fixing block 64, the front end and the rear end of the first fixing block 61 and the front end and the rear end of the second fixing block 64 are connected with connecting screws 65 in a threaded mode together, and the protective cover 7 and the platform main body 1 are connected in a threaded mode through the connecting screws 65 to increase the use stability of the device; the rear end of the first fixing block 61 is in threaded connection with the platform main body 1 through a connecting screw 65, and the rear end of the second fixing block 64 is in threaded connection with the protective cover 7 through the connecting screw 65, so that the stability and the connectivity of the device in the using process are improved; the upper ends of the two connecting plates 62 are in a round corner edge structure, the lower end of the second fixing block 64 is in a round foot edge structure, the two connecting plates 62 are not in contact with the second fixing block 64, and the connecting structure 6 improves the flexibility of the protective cover 7 in the turning process; the protective cover 7 comprises a first protective plate 71, the lower end of the first protective plate 71 is fixedly connected with a second protective plate 72, the middle parts of the upper ends of the first protective plate 71 and the second protective plate 72 are respectively provided with a first protective groove 73 and a second protective groove 74, so that the cleanness of the display screen and the platform main body 1 in a closed state is improved, and the time for wiping in a second use is reduced; front end and the 6 threaded connection of connection structure of a protection shield 71, the size and the display screen groove 5 size of a protection shield 71 are unanimous, the size of No. two protection shields 72 is unanimous with the upper end size of platform main part 1, No. two protection shield 74 are located No. two protection shields 72 outsidess, visor 7 is to the safety protection nature of device main part when increasing the device closure, platform main part 1 outside sets up to the fillet limit structure simultaneously, reduce the outside scratch condition to the unexpected injury of user's emergence scratch, simultaneously when protection shield 7 closure state, it hides grey to reduce the ash that falls down of operation platform, increase operation platform's cleanliness factor, clean the labour of cleaning when reducing the use operation platform, whole device simple structure, and convenient operation.
